Paul Pogba 'still wants Manchester United exit this summer'

Manchester United midfielder Paul Pogba has reportedly claimed that he still wants to leave the club this summer, despite looking forward to playing alongside new signing Bruno Fernandes.

The Frenchman, who has been out of action since December with an ankle injury, is keen to link up with the club's new signing and form a partnership with the Portuguese international.

However, according to Tuttosport, the 26-year-old is still wanting to part ways with the Red Devils at the end of the season with a move to either Juventus or Real Madrid as his likely destination.

The subject surrounding Pogba's future has been in speculation all season despite the World Cup winner spending the majority of the campaign on the sidelines.

Pogba also missed Manchester United's recent 3-0 FA Cup win against Derby County which sees them progress into the quarter-finals against Norwich City.
